Sidetracking bit
Sidetrack bits are a specialized type of drilling tool that play a vital role in creating sidetracks and performing complex wellbore rerouting tasks. These bits are designed to handle conditions where it is necessary to change the drilling direction or to bypass difficult geological areas such as collapse zones, unstable formations or previous problematic wellbore.
Major Applications
Sidetrack bits are widely used in sidetracking, an increasingly popular technology for increasing reservoir coverage and improving hydrocarbon production. They are also used in redevelopment of older wells to reactivate or improve production using new branches.
When it is necessary to change the drilling path, sidetrack bits provide an effective sidetrack (cut) into the borehole wall to start a new wellbore. These bits help create a stable and controllable new path for drilling, allowing you to work with high precision.

Design Features
Side-cutting bits have specially designed cutting elements and blades that provide effective rock destruction when cutting into the borehole wall. The special shape of the bit helps to accurately control the direction of drilling, reducing the risk of deviations and providing control over the trajectory. Modern models are equipped with systems for optimal weight distribution on the bit, which increases stability and reduces wear.
